Carbyne, CentralSquare Combine 911 Technologies to Improve Emergency Response

The partnership between the public safety providers is said to add value by improving emergency response time and situational awareness.

NEW YORK — Carbyne, a provider of public safety technology and CentralSquare, a provider of public safety and public administration software, announce they are joining forces via a strategic technology partnership.

Together, the streamlined experience Carbyne’s c-Live Universe platform offers will build on the intuitive interface and usability of CentralSquare’s current 911 and Computer Aided Dispatch (CAD) solutions for an even more agile emergency response, according to the company.

The combination of the two next-generation 911 technologies together is said to further empower their customers to achieve greater situational awareness through actionable, real-time data.

The unification of CentralSquare’s broad portfolio of fully integrated public safety software solutions with Carbyne’s Cloud-native platform, delivers next-level efficiency and intelligence, enhancing operations, command decisions and response, according to an announcement.

Currently, CentralSquare serves more than 5,000 public safety agencies across the U.S. Those agencies leverage its Next Generation 911 system, which the company says provides unparalleled access to caller information and automated tools, helping dispatchers send the right responders to the right place as fast as possible.

The new partnership will give those agencies access to Carbyne’s c-Live Universe platform and the ability to receive critical incident data, dynamic location, text and on-the-scene video.
